Episode #235: Martin Puryear addresses the interconnected narratives around the fabrication and installation of his works, as evidenced by his monumental public sculpture Big Bling (2016). "There's a story in the making of objects," said the artist in an archival interview with Art21. "There's a narrative in the fabrication of things, which to me is fascinating."

Because Puryear could not produce the colossal 40-foot sculpture in his studio, he worked with a team of expert manufacturers to realize his vision. At Unalam, a specialty lumber fabricator in Sidney, New York, glulam wood beams were bent to create the tight curves specified by his design. Jon Lash of Digital Atelier explains how materials such as chain link fencing were chosen to create an industrial-looking surface, which contrasts with the golden "bling" at the sculpture’s peak.

"Big Bling" was on view in Madison Square Park in New York City through January 2017 and was later presented in Philadelphia through November 2017 by the Association for Public Art.

Martin Puryear's sculptures—in wood, stone, tar, wire, and various metals—marry minimalist logic with traditional methods of making. Puryear's explorations in abstract forms retain vestigial elements of utility from everyday objects, while introducing unusual shapes that complicate the aesthetic and encourage sustained viewing. A form that reoccurs in Puryear's work is the hollow mass, a solid shape emanating qualities of uncertainty and emptiness.
